Former Columbus police vice officer Andrew Mitchell has been found not guilty of murder and voluntary manslaughter in connection with the fatal shooting of 23-year-old Donna Dalton Castleberry in August 2018. The jury deliberated for about five hours before reaching their verdict. Mitchell remains in police custody and faces multiple federal charges related to forcing women to perform sexual acts in exchange for their freedom and lying to federal investigators. Mitchell's attorney said the process for charging officers has not been fair for a long time.
